Recommended Temperature Setpoints
The temperature setting is determined, among other things, by the
processing temperature prescribed by the material supplier.
CAUTION: Nordson will grant no warranty and assume no liability for
damage resulting from incorrect temperature settings.
Grid
Up to 20°C (36°F) below prescribed processing temperature
Reservoir Prescribed processing temperature
(Material quantity used <50 g/min: 0 to 10°C (18°F) below prescribed
processing temperature
Undertemperature value
(warning)
10°C (18°F) below set processing temperature
Air heater: approx. 10°C (18°F) below set processing temperature
Undertemperature value (fault) 15°C (27°F) below set processing temperature
Air heater: approx. 20°C (36°F) below set processing temperature
Overtemperature value
(warning)
10°C (18°F) above set processing temperature
Air heater: approx. 10°C (18°F) above set processing temperature
Overtemperature value (fault) 15°C (27°F) above set processing temperature
Air heater: approx. 20°C (36°F) above set processing temperature
Filling valve (option) Prescribed processing temperature*
Applicator (accessory) Prescribed processing temperature(s)*
Hose (accessory) Prescribed processing temperature*
* CAUTION: The maximum operating temperature of the installed applicator and the other heated
components should be considered when setting temperatures on the melter control panel. Refer to Control
Panel - Overview - / T1.
